After completing the Fishermen's Trail we will begin a two-week whirlwind bus and train tour of southern Spain. With stops in Seville, Granada, Córdoba, Mérida, and Salamanca, we look forward to experiencing the history, culture, cuisine, and viticulture of the region.
From Salamanca it is a short three day walk along the Via de la Plata to Zamora, our home for two weeks as volunteers at the municipal Albergue. Albergues make up about three quarters of our accommodations when we are walking so it will be nice to give back a little, before we strap on our packs and begin the Camino Sanabrés, a 400 km walk to Santiago de Compostella.
